Actor Richard Gere attended a 5 day Buddhist gathering at Bodh Gaya in Bihar, India. Bodh Gaya is regarded as the holy site where Gautama Buddha attained enlightenment meditating under a Bodhi Tree. Gere said he is strongly in favor for turning Bodh Gaya into a vegetarian zone. An exemplary idea since, after all, the main purpose of the Buddha’s appearance on earth was to spread the doctrine of “Ahimsa” or non-violence, specifically to stop the killing of animals.
